Zapier Integration
Connect Rankfender to 5,000+ apps via Zapier:
- Trigger: Article published in Rankfender
- Action: Post to Slack, send email, update spreadsheet, etc.
Use the Rankfender webhook to trigger Zapier workflows. Configure a Zapier Webhook trigger pointed at your Zap's catch hook URL.
Make (Integromat)
Build complex multi-step workflows:
- Create a new Scenario in Make
- Add a Webhook module as the trigger
- Configure Rankfender to send webhooks to the Make webhook URL
- Add action modules (Google Sheets, Slack, email, etc.)
Custom CMS Integration
For websites not using WordPress, use the webhook integration to receive published content:
- Set up a webhook endpoint on your server
- Receive the article payload from Rankfender
- Store the content in your CMS or database
- Return the published URL to Rankfender

Analytics Integration
Pull Rankfender data into your analytics stack:
// Example: Fetch keyword performance for a custom dashboard
const response = await fetch(
'https://api.rankfender.com/v1/projects/proj_123/keywords',
{
headers: {
'Authorization': 'Bearer YOUR_API_KEY',
'Content-Type': 'application/json'
}
}
);
